I went for my doctor’s visit yesterday and received lots of good news.  They took out my stitches, and they told me that I don’t have to wear any braces when I am at home.  When I’m moving around, they said I should use either my sports brace (picture forthcoming at some point), or the crutches.  Also, I can start driving pretty much whenever I want, since I have stopped taking Lortab completely as of two days ago.  I might attempt that on Friday.

I also had a PT appointment yesterday, and they threw in some new exercises.  These involved standing up and doing calf raises, balancing on my left leg (while holding on to a bar to steady myself) and marching in place.

Also, at PT I walked (more like hobbled) completely on my own without crutches or a brace for the first time.  That was a big moment for me, as I didn’t think I could really do it.  Now, I really feel like I’m getting over closer to being back to normal.

So at this point, I just keep going to PT and working out at home.  I go back to the doctor on August 10th, and I’ve pretty much decided to head back to Auburn on August 11th, as I should be pretty capable at that point.
